Canadian Oil Sands - Canada's Energy Advantage

 

 

Join Don Thompson, Executive Advisor, Sustainability and Oil Sands Outreach, Canadian Oil Sands Limited, as he addresses how Okanagan service and goods producers can do business with oil sands companies.
The oil sands are a Canadian treasure. As we move forward developing this resource, we must continue to work to achieve the balance between economic contribution, environmental sustainability and energy security. According to the Canadian Energy Research Institute, by 2035, 905,000 jobs will come to be linked to the oil sands as a result of its ongoing development. The oil sands will make this significant contribution by creating supply chain and employment opportunities across the continent in addition to direct employment within the industry.
